Product Design Engineer (University Grad)
At Reality Labs we aim to bring together the brightest cross-disciplinary minds in one place to deliver on our mission: build tools that help people feel connected, anytime, anywhere. As a Product Design Engineer, you will take a critical role in developing hardware systems for Smart Glasses products. You will become part of a team exploring developing concepts through prototyping and into mass-production consumer electronics. You will work as part of a cross functional team requiring collaboration and curiosity in domains other than mechanical engineering. Our ideal candidate has strong mechanical engineering fundamentals, prototyping skills, CAD fluency, and manufacturing process knowledge.Product Design Engineer (University Grad) Responsibilities

- Contribute to mechanical solutions as part of a highly cross-functional team
- Model, build, test, and refine prototypes and characterization test systems
- Work across the full product development cycle, from concept inception to shipping product
- Collaborate and manage work with Asia-based Supply Chain
- Push state-of-the-art technologies and approaches to solving complex mechanical problems while working with cross functional technical teams
- Design modules and subsystems using CAD software
- Travel to external vendors up to 15%
- Currently has, or is in the process of obtaining, Bachelors degree in Mechanical Engineering, relevant technical field, or equivalent practical experience. Degree must be completed prior to joining Meta
- Understanding of material properties, including plastics, metals, adhesives, and glass
- Familiarity with design for manufacturability (DFM), design for assembly (DFA), and statistical tolerance analysis techniques
- Experience with high-volume manufacturing techniques (e.g., injection molding, machining, 3D printing, die-cutting, etc)
- Demonstrated understanding of mechanical constraints systems, part tolerancing, and assembly stackups
- Experience working independently, navigating ambiguous situations, and driving projects forward
- 1+ year Experience with engineering fundamentals, including: Mechanics of Solids, Statics, Dynamics, Materials, Thermodynamics, Fluid mechanics, Statistics
- Experience working and communicating cross-functionally in a team environment.
- Must obtain work authorization in country of employment at the time of hire, and maintain ongoing work authorization during employment.
- Currently has or is in the process of obtaining a Masters degree in Mechanical Engineering or a related field
- Co-op or internship experience in product design and development, preferably in the consumer electronics industry
- Experience with NX CAD or similar software
- Familiarity with industrial design principles
- Strong problem-solving skills, including failure analysis and statistical evaluation methodology
